Claims 4, 13, 22 and 28 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ention. Regarding claims 4, 13, 22 and 28, the phrase "minimum of … or …" in line 3 renders the claim indefinite because it is unclear whether the “minimum” means in the limitation. The examiner understood it as “minimum of the limitation for the total quantity of repetitions and a floor value of a ratio of the limit of link layer blocks and the quantity of the one or more negative acknowledgments” for the examination purpose. See the equation (2) in the specification [0074] in the form of MIN (A, B) which is minimum of A and B. Claims 1-3, 10-12, 19-21 and 25-27 are rejected under 35 U.S.C. 102(a)(2) as being anticipated by Priyanto et al. (US Pub. 2024/0163022). Regarding claims 1, 10, 19 and 25, Priyanto teaches a first wireless device, comprising: a processing system that includes processor circuitry and memory circuitry that stores code, the processing system configured to cause the first wireless device to: transmit a payload to a second wireless device, wherein the payload is segmented into a plurality of link layer blocks, each link layer block of the plurality of link layer blocks comprising a respective portion of the payload (“the TB can be even further structured into the code block groups (CBGs) and each CBG can include a respective checksum. This helps to limit the retransmissions to fractions of the initial TB, i.e., CBG-based retransmissions” in [0067]); receive, from the second wireless device, one or more negative acknowledgments associated with the plurality of link layer blocks (step 9505 NACK in Figure 3); and transmit, to the second wireless device, a quantity of repetitions of at least one link layer block associated with the one or more negative acknowledgments (“the retransmission protocol 900 triggers a retransmission 902 at least of the corrupted parts of the DL data 4030—e.g., one or more corrupted CBGs could be retransmitted” in [0074]), wherein the quantity of repetitions is associated with a quantity of the one or more negative acknowledgments (When there is only one corrupted CBG, 212, the corrupted CBG 212 is repeated 4 times in Figure 7. And when there are two corrupted CBGs, 211 and 212, the corrupted CBG 211 is repeated 2 times and the corrupted CBG is repeated 3 times in Figure 9) and a limit of link layer blocks associated with the payload (see when the block can handle 4 repetitions of CBG in Figure 7 and when the block can handle only 2 repetitions of CBG in Figure 8). Regarding claims 2, 11, 20 and 26, Priyanto teaches the processing system is further configured to cause the first wireless device to: receive an indication of a capability of the second wireless device to receive link layer block repetitions, wherein transmitting the quantity of repetitions is associated with receiving the indication of the capability. Regarding claims 3, 12, 21 and 27, Priyanto teaches the quantity of repetitions is associated with a limitation for a total quantity of repetitions of the at least one link layer block (see when the block can handle 4 repetitions of CBG in Figure 7 and when the block can handle only 2 repetitions of CBG in Figure 8). Claims 8, 9, 17 and 18 are rejected under 35 U.S.C. 103 as being unpatentable over Priyanto et al. in view of Fouad et al. (US Pub. 2024/0421945). Regarding claims 8 and 17, Priyanto teaches transmitting the quantity of repetitions is associated with a first priority of a first link layer block of the plurality of link layer blocks relative to a second priority of a second link layer block of the plurality of link layer blocks (“the number of repetitions may instead (or also) be based on the priority of the CBGs or on the packet delay budget (with, e.g., CBGs with a priority or packet delay budget above a respective threshold (which may be configured, or standard-specified, or dynamically indicated to the UE by the target UE 115) being retransmitted more times)” in [0077]). Regarding claims 9 and 18, Fouad teaches a first quantity of repetitions for the first link layer block is greater than a second quantity of repetitions for the second link layer block based at least in part on the first priority being higher than the second priority (“the number of repetitions may instead (or also) be based on the priority of the CBGs or on the packet delay budget (with, e.g., CBGs with a priority or packet delay budget above a respective threshold (which may be configured, or standard-specified, or dynamically indicated to the UE by the target UE 115) being retransmitted more times)” in [0077]). Allowable Subject Matter Claims 4, 13, 22 and 28 would be allowable if rewritten to overcome the rejection(s) under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), 2nd paragraph, set forth in this Office action and to include all of the limitations of the base claim and any intervening claims. Claims 5-7, 14-16, 23, 24, 29 and 30 are objected to as being dependent upon a rejected base claim, but would be allowable if rewritten in independent form including all of the limitations of the base claim and any intervening claims.
